"I wanted to wait until the summer...to reflect on the last three-and-a-half years," he told Gary Lineker during the BBC's FA Cup coverage. "I thoroughly enjoyed my time at Liverpool...hopefully in the summer I get the chance to get back in [to management] again."Rodgers admitted he had been approached by clubs overseas, and is not ruling out a move to a club outside the Premier League. With Manchester City confirming Pep Guardiola's impending arrival and Manchester United preparing to welcome Jose Mourinho, Rodgers would have slim pickings if he wants a top job in the Premier League (not that either of those clubs would necessarily have been interested). But Rodgers' stock is still relatively high after Liverpool's second-place finish in the 2013/14 season, and Rodgers - when questioned about opportunities abroad, said "I'm open to travel."
